Property Report
This semi-detached house, built between 1950-1966, boasts a floor area of 93 square metres. It features fully double-glazed windows and a pitched roof with 300mm loft insulation. The property has a current energy rating of 'D', while its potential energy rating value is 'B'.The property's running costs are £1,075 per year, and its energy consumption is 239 units per year. The house is located in Morpeth, Northumberland, and has a postcode of NE61 5RD.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 807 out of 999.
